The double-subtraction observation technique employed to detect the Suniaev-Zel'dovich effect is presented with respect to its use in the radio lobes of 0742 + 318, 1721 + 343, 2221 {minus} 02, and 2349 + 32. The procedure is described, and the results show that the jet minimum pressure is always exceeded by the upper limit on the radio lobe pressure from the effect. Magnetic pressure is therefore not required to confine the jets, and the upper limits on the jet Mach number are set relative to an intergalactic medium by utilizing the pressure limits, the adiabatic shock condition, and the estimated pressure of the intergalactic medium. 23 refs.
